Russel Metals (TSE:RUS) Director Sells C$273,600.00 in Stock

Key Points

  • Director Brian Robie Hedges sold 4,800 shares of Russel Metals on May 11 for about C$273,600 at C$57.00 per share, reducing his holdings by 32.43% to 10,000 shares.
  • Hedges also made additional sales earlier in the week, including 10,000 shares for C$570,000 and 200 shares for C$11,422, all around the same C$57 price level.
  • Russel Metals reported solid fundamentals and shareholder returns, posting C$1.30 EPS for the quarter and announcing a quarterly dividend of C$0.44 per share, equal to a 3.1% annualized yield.

Russel Metals Inc. (TSE:RUS - Get Free Report) Director Brian Robie Hedges sold 4,800 shares of Russel Metals stock in a transaction on Monday, May 11th. The stock was sold at an average price of C$57.00, for a total transaction of C$273,600.00. Following the sale, the director directly owned 10,000 shares in the company, valued at approximately C$570,000. This trade represents a 32.43% decrease in their position.

Brian Robie Hedges also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Friday, May 8th, Brian Robie Hedges sold 10,000 shares of Russel Metals stock. The shares were sold at an average price of C$57.00, for a total transaction of C$570,000.00.
  • On Friday, May 8th, Brian Robie Hedges sold 200 shares of Russel Metals stock. The stock was sold at an average price of C$57.11, for a total transaction of C$11,422.00.

Russel Metals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Russel Metals is one of the largest metals distribution companies in North America with a growing focus on value-added processing. It carries on business in three segments: metals service centers, energy field stores and steel distributors. Its network of metals service centers carries an extensive line of metal products in a wide range of sizes, shapes and specifications, including carbon hot rolled and cold finished steel, pipe and tubular products, stainless steel, aluminum and other non-ferrous specialty metals.
